We are recruiting for a Duty Manager to join our Service Delivery team at SYNLAB Laboratory Services on a full time and permanent basis (hybrid role). The role will involve 24/7 coverage of our collections booking line which includes lone working (including nights and weekend shifts), as well as acting as the point of contact for the collection service.
SYNLAB Laboratory Services is part of SYNLAB UK & Ireland, who provide laboratory diagnostic and training services to a diverse range of sectors including healthcare and wellness, sport, travel, corporates and insurers, logistics and family law.
Our site in Abergavenny has 2 in-house laboratories, offering a wide range of pathology tests including occupational health and wellness tests, as well as workplace drug and alcohol testing. In addition to our laboratories providing UKAS accredited ISO/IEC 17025 and ISO 15189 testing, we are one of only a few providers offering an end-to-end in-house collection and laboratory service.
